Transaction 14fa4973fdd2136bc506dc45ffce4ae9a788620d905c801dff304a61dad5aee9

1 Input
2 Outputs
  • 14fa4973fdd2136bc506dc45ffce4ae9a788620d905c801dff304a61dad5aee9:0
  • value  33452147
    address  3MVXSkaF6vAhoekLjSudPuTLpv67kCRyny
  • 14fa4973fdd2136bc506dc45ffce4ae9a788620d905c801dff304a61dad5aee9:1
  • value  490213
    address  17hnhkno9cwbtBnFaspFQkMCK4V6C2qCDC